Direct Sportslink secured legendary Coach Jimmy Johnson for Corecentric's conference. A legendary and National Championship Head Football Coach for the Miami Hurricanes and a two-time Super Bowl Champion Head Coach for the Dallas Cowboys, Coach Johnson was an ideal keynote speaker. Coach shared his thoughts on teamwork, leadership, and adversity from a coaching viewpoint that very few can do. After retiring from coaching Coach wnet on to a very successful broadcasting career for FOX covering NFL games.
